Leila says that 75% of a number will always be greater than 50% of any other number. Complete one inequality to support Leila's

claim and one to show that she is incorrect

<h2>Answer with explanation:</h2>

Let a and be two numbers.

Leila says that 75% of a number will always be greater than 50% of any other number.

This means that:

                   0.75×a > 0.50×b

( Since 75% of a=0.75×a

and 50% of b =0.50×b )

1)

Numbers that support Leila's claim.

Let a=100 and b=10

0.75×a=0.75×100=75

and 0.50×10=5

As we know that:

               75 > 5

Hence, a=100 and b=10 support Leila's claim.

2)

Numbers that refutes her claim.

Let a=1 and b=200

0.75×a=0.75×1=0.75

and 0.50×200=100

As we know that:

               0.75 < 100

Hence, a=1 and b=200 refutes Leila's claim.

A circle has a diameter of 14 feet. What is the circumference of the circle? Use 3:14 for pie.
Marianna [84]

Answer:

Circumference= 43.96 feet

Step-by-step explanation:

Diameter of the circle= 14 feet

Radius of the circle= 14/2= 7 feet

Circumference of the circle= 2\pi r

As, \pi =\frac{22}{7}=3.14

Circumference:

                          =2*3.14*7\\\\=3.14*14\\\\=43.96feet

The circumference of the circle with the radius= 7 feet is 43.96 feet
